Default No Radio signal or white noise?

Hi all,
My PYE valve radio was restored back in 2013, worked well for a few years, but then one day, I switched it on and there was power but no signal what so ever?
So then I left it thought it was broke, then I switched it on a few months ago, then it was working But then after a hour, no signal what so ever. I have sprayed the switches with switch cleaner, but still nothing?
I wish there was someone who lived closer to come and have a look at it?
Any ideas most welcomed?

There's not a complete picture, but the photo suggests the set's internal loudspeaker is connected to the chassis by a brown/black cable and those two red banana plugs.

Has the contact of the red plugs just become poor? Try giving those a wiggle with the set at low volume and see if the speaker crackles and starts to hum.

Go carefully if the set has no protective back panel, there are potentially lethal voltages present inside the cabinet and also on that black (diagonal) voltage selector plug just to the right.

Has the tone corrector capacitor C31 (photo 3) mounted on the output transformer been replaced? Could have been missed.
If it went short it may take out the output transformer and all would be quiet.
